Overview of the DUMOS 12-in-1 Electric Pressure Cooker

The DUMOS 12-in-1 Electric Pressure Cooker is priced at $79.69, making it a budget-friendly option for those looking to simplify their cooking experience. With a 6-quart capacity, it is designed for versatility, handling everything from pressure cooking to steaming and slow cooking. This multi-cooker is built to last, featuring a robust stainless steel design that not only enhances durability but also adds a modern touch to your kitchen.

Overview of the Instant Pot

The Instant Pot, priced at $129.99, offers a larger 8-quart capacity and nine cooking functions. This appliance is engineered for convenience, boasting features like WhisperQuiet technology for a quieter cooking experience and guided cooking with over 800 recipes available through its app. The Instant Pot's higher price reflects its extensive capabilities, making it suitable for larger families and those who often entertain.

Cooking Versatility

The DUMOS cooker stands out with its 12 cooking functions, allowing users to pressure cook, steam, slow cook, sauté, and more—all in one appliance. This versatility makes it an excellent choice for busy households looking to minimize the number of kitchen gadgets. The Instant Pot, while slightly less versatile with its nine functions, still offers a range of options, including sous vide and cake making. Both products cater to varied culinary needs, though the DUMOS provides a broader range of cooking methods.

Capacity Comparison

When it comes to capacity, the Instant Pot leads the way with its 8-quart size, ideal for accommodating up to eight servings. This makes it perfect for larger families or meal prepping for the week. In contrast, the DUMOS offers a 6-quart capacity, which is still ample for most family meals or gatherings but may require multiple batches for larger groups. The difference in capacity could influence your choice depending on your cooking needs and the size of your household.

Ease of Use

The DUMOS electric pressure cooker is designed with user-friendliness in mind, featuring an intuitive interface that allows for easy operation. Its non-stick inner pot and removable components make cleanup straightforward, letting you spend more time enjoying your meals rather than scrubbing pots. The Instant Pot also emphasizes ease of use with its guided cooking feature, which provides step-by-step instructions and an angled control panel. However, the additional features of the Instant Pot may require a bit more time to master initially.

Cleaning and Maintenance

Both the DUMOS and Instant Pot prioritize easy cleanup, but they do so in slightly different ways. The DUMOS features a non-stick inner pot and dishwasher-safe parts, ensuring minimal hassle after cooking. The Instant Pot also boasts a dishwasher-safe lid and inner pot, which simplifies maintenance. If cleaning time is a significant factor in your decision-making, both options offer efficient solutions, but the DUMOS may provide a quicker cleanup experience due to its straightforward design.

Safety Features

Safety is paramount in kitchen appliances, and both the DUMOS and Instant Pot come equipped with essential safety mechanisms. The Instant Pot is notable for its over 10 safety features, including overheat protection and an easy seal safety lid lock, providing peace of mind during use. The DUMOS lacks detailed specifications regarding its safety features, but its robust construction suggests it is built with durability in mind. For users who prioritize safety and reliability, the Instant Pot offers a more comprehensive safety profile.

Which should you buy?

Deciding between the DUMOS 12-in-1 Electric Pressure Cooker and the Instant Pot largely depends on your cooking needs and budget. The DUMOS is about 38% cheaper at $79.69 compared to the Instant Pot's $129.99, making it a fantastic entry-level option for those looking for versatility without breaking the bank. However, if you frequently cook for larger gatherings or value advanced features like guided cooking and WhisperQuiet technology, the Instant Pot may justify its higher price. Ultimately, both are solid choices, but your specific requirements will determine the best fit for your kitchen.
